Luke Jensen knows more than a little about tennis' most outstanding strokes. His unique delivery helped him capture 10 Tour doubles titles, including the 1993 French Open with his brother, Murphy; and he reached a career-high world doubles ranking of No. 6. We asked him what lessons you should (and shouldn't) take from the best shots from the game's best players.

Barton Creek Resort & Spa in Austin, Texas, is home to four courses, and head pro Justin Kutz recommends the Fazio Foothills for both its beauty and its challenges. The course features a natural limestone cave, waterfalls, and dramatic cliffs. From the tee, its narrow fairways intimidate. But Kutz says don't be quick to stick that driver back in the bag.
